Output 58f2929b55156ec9e090a20b1566a9adc8e95446403dcc90f6b96af5a4b4edd4:7

value
4153
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c968b69de62e63c2400ec8552ce26d2f9fee9c6ce79a13a8cfdfe33b9517fb2d
address
ltc1pe95td80x9e3uysqwep2jecnd9707a8rvu7dp82x0ml3nh9ghlvkske2rkr
transaction
58f2929b55156ec9e090a20b1566a9adc8e95446403dcc90f6b96af5a4b4edd4
spent
true